Output 18b80c2def6faafe0614370317d6b337809608ddedfbd10d0cf4f044df85e1c3:2

value
1062407
script pubkey
OP_0 OP_PUSHBYTES_20 3c3fb79b43cadb13a7fbd593f63085bf48167433
address
bc1q8slm0x6retd38flm6kflvvy9haypvapn94dxj5
transaction
18b80c2def6faafe0614370317d6b337809608ddedfbd10d0cf4f044df85e1c3
spent
true